Volvo increases production of first diesel hybrid

$
0
0
First 1000 examples of V60 hybrid have already been sold

Volvo has already made plans to increase production of its first diesel-electric hybrid, despite the model not being launched until 2013.

The initial 1000-car production run of the V60 hybrid has already found buyers, so the Swedish firm plans to increase output to 4000-6000 cars from 2014.

Although technical highlights of the plug-in hybrid have yet to be announced, Volvo claims a range of up to 32 miles from the 11.2kW lithium ion battery alone, while the diesel engine to which it is mated will undoubtedly be a pre-existing Volvo unit.

Along with the new battery, the V60 hybrid features more than 300 extra parts over the standard V60, including the battery cooling system, high-voltage cables and additional battery drive shaft.

The hybrid, which has been built in co-operation with Swedish electricity supplier Vattenfall, will be assembled on the same production line as the standard V60, V70, XC70, S80 and XC90 models at Volvo’s Torslanda plant in Gothenburg.
